Head to head
| Measure | Mazda 6 | Mazda Cx-60 exclusive-line d mhev a |
|---|---|---|
| MOT pass rate | 75% | 92% ✓ |
| MOT failure rate | 25% | 8% ✓ |
| Faults & advisories per test | 1.9 | 1.5 ✓ |
| Dangerous-fault share | 2% ✓ | 10% |
| Average mileage | 113,866 mi | 20,874 mi |
| Sample size (vehicles) | 159,403 | 71 |
